EDITORS COMMENTS
In this poignant moment at Goodison Park on May 7,2006, a line-up of Everton Football Club players and staff paid tribute to the late Brian Labone during a pre-match ceremony. Labone, a legendary figure in Everton's history, had passed away earlier that year at the age of 65. The FA Barclays Premiership match against West Bromwich Albion was an emotional occasion for all involved, as the Everton community came together to remember and honor the life of their beloved former player and captain. Labone spent 12 years at Goodison Park, making over 400 appearances for the club between 1960 and 1972. He was a key figure in Everton's success during that period, helping the team win the Football League Championship in 1962 and 1963, as well as the FA Cup in 1966. As the teams lined up on the pitch, a minute's silence was observed in memory of Labone. The players wore black armbands as a sign of respect, and the crowd held a banner bearing Labone's name and the number 5, which he wore during his time at Everton. The atmosphere was somber, yet filled with a sense of pride and appreciation for the man who had given so much to the club.
